#ifndef FIX_GROUP
#define FIX_GROUP
#ifdef _MSC_VER
#pragma warning(disable : 4786)
#endif
#include "FieldMap.h"
#include "Fields.h"
#include <vector>
namespace FIX {
/**
* Base class for all %FIX repeating groups.
*
* A group consists of a count field, deliminator, and a sorting order.
*/
class Group : public FieldMap {
public:
Group(int field, int delim)
: FieldMap(message_order(delim, 0)),
m_field(field),
m_delim(delim) {}
Group(int field, int delim, const int order[])
: FieldMap(order),
m_field(field),
m_delim(delim) {}
Group(int field, int delim, const message_order &order)
: FieldMap(order),
m_field(field),
m_delim(delim) {}
Group(const Group ©)
: FieldMap(copy),
m_field(copy.m_field),
m_delim(copy.m_delim) {}
int field() const { return m_field; }
int delim() const { return m_delim; }
void addGroup(const Group &group);
void replaceGroup(unsigned num, const Group &group);
Group &getGroup(unsigned num, Group &group) const EXCEPT(FieldNotFound);
void removeGroup(unsigned num, const Group &group);
void removeGroup(const Group &group);
bool hasGroup(const Group &group);
bool hasGroup(unsigned num, const Group &group);
private:
int m_field;
int m_delim;
};
} // namespace FIX
#endif // FIX_GROUP
